JavaScript
jQuery
조밈밍
2022. 3. 13. 23:28
<라이브러리>
: 자주 사용하는 로직을 재사용할 수 있도록 고안된 소프트웨어 라이브러리
<jQuery>
: DOM을 내부에 감추고 보다 쉽게 웹페이지를 조작할 수 있도록 돕는 도구
☞ 최신버전 : <script src="http://code.jquery.com/jquery-latest.min.js"></script>
<jQuery 기본문법>
: $('태그 선택자').css('color', 'blue');
* $() == jQuery 함수
$('태그 선택자') == 리턴값, jQuery 객체
=> jQuery로 간단하게 작성 가능
* class는 . id는 #
<jQuery 객체>
☞ $(태그 선택자).css(효과, 설정값); -> 설정
$('li').css('text-decoration', 'underline');
☞ $(태그 선택자).css(효과); -> 가져오기
$('li').css('text-decoration');
-> text-decoration 효과의 값을 가려오려고 함, underline
<jQuery 조회 범위 제한>
☞ selector context : 조회할때 조회 범위 제한
: 둘 다 실행결과 같다
☞ .find() : jQuery 객체 내에 엘리먼트 조회
: 체인을 끊지 않고 작업의 대상을 변경하고 싶을 때 사용
: 위와 같이 바꿀수 있다.
: 보통 위와 같이 사용된다